INDORE: A sessions court in Indore on Friday awarded three years imprisonment to a woman who turned hostile in a case where she had made allegations of gangrape and blackmail against her two colleagues.The case was registered at Gandhi Nagar police station in 2017, in which the complainant had alleged that Satish Rathore and Madhur Maulasariya made an obscene video of her and threatened her on multiple occasions..
